Bruce Momjian wrote:
> I have researched this and the incorrect behavior seems to be totally
> caused by the fact that unquoted commas are treated as item separators
> in pg_hba.conf.
>
> I have updated the documentation in 8.2 and CVS HEAD to indicate that
> the LDAP URL should be double-quoted, and double-quoted the example URL
> for emphasis.
>
> If double-quoting does not 100% fix your problem, please let us know.
> Thanks.
>
> Documentation patch attached.
>

I've been working off-list with the other person who reported the same
problem, and for him the problem was fixed with the double quotes. I was
actually just about to start on that documentation update myself, thanks
for taking care of it.
